> Ryan,
>
> Hartshorne is a great place - all year. It's 50 miles from
Parsippany, so I guess you'll want to save that for a weekend ride.
At least this time of year there won't be any "shore traffic".
>
> Take 287 South to GSP south to exit 117-Keyport. Take Rt 36,
southeast for 10 miles, into Atlantic Highlands. At the light where
Valley Drive (8a) goes straight and 36 curves off to the left, stay
right onto Valley. Follow Valley Dr. (8a) ½ mile to intersection of
Monmouth Ave, Locust Ave., Hartshorne Rd, and Navesink Ave., bear
left onto Navesink Ave (8b). The trailhead is a short way ahead on
the right.
>
> Have you ridden Lewis Morris Park during the winter? I rode there
quite a few times this past spring. It's a great park, but I would
expect it to be much colder than South Jersey during the winter.
>
> Carlos
